Reported Incidents of Somali Pirate Attacks and Hijakings in the Gulf of Aden for 2008 (as of 12 Jan 2009)

Map of 'Reported%20Incidents%20of%20Somali%20Pirate%20Attacks%20and%20Hijakings%20in%20the%20Gulf%20of%20Aden%20for%202008%20(as%20of%2012%20Jan%202009)'

This map illustrates reported incidents of piracy in the Gulf of Aden in 2008 and was produced by UNOSAT in support of the ongoing humanitarian operations across the Horn of Africa, and in response to the UN Security Council Resolutions 1851, 1838 & 1816 (2008), and IMO resolution adopted 29 Nov. 2007 calling for increased monitoring of Somali pirate activity. Satellite imagery has been used in this analysis for the dectection of suspected hijacked vessel locations between the villages of Eyl & Hobyo. All piracy incident data has been obtained from open sources. Map Scale for A2: 1:2,750,000, Projection : Transverse Mercator, Datum : WGS 1984.
